On the Fourier transform of random Bernoulli convolutions

math.DS · 2025-07-29 · accept · novelty 7.0

For random Bernoulli convolutions, the Fourier transform is in L^1 almost surely whenever λ_g > 2/π, giving absolute continuity and non-empty interior; polynomial Fourier decay holds for every λ_g.
